Evgeny Burmentyev <[email protected]> added the comment: Yes, the file has both id3v1 and id3v2 tags in it (which is quite common and is default for many taggers, like foobar2000 and taglib). I guess, it reads id3v1 fields instead of id3v2. I think, id3v2 should be given a priority in such cases. I must add, that when a file has only id3v2 tags, ffmpeg reads them correctly.
